Patio Doors

Patio doors are designed to open your home to a stunning views and provide plenty of light. The style of patio doors you select will be based on your personal preferences as well as the style and design of your home. There are a myriad of options available for new construction and renovations. You can choose from swinging patio doors, or French doors to elegant folding doors.

During the installation of patio doors the gaps between frame and the masonry have to be completely filled with insulation material. The foam, which is used to fill these gaps, can be injected or applied to the gap using a brush. In both instances the foam should be dosed properly to ensure that it expands to fill in the gaps between the masonry and the frame of the patio door (fig. 6).

Another important aspect of patio door installation is the security they offer. High quality patio doors are specifically designed with security locking systems that keep your home safe. This includes multi-point locking systems as well as concealed shoot bolts that prevent forced entry or theft.

When you are choosing a patio door, it is also a good idea to consider how easy it will be to maintain. uPVC, aluminium and other sturdy materials are easily cleaned with a damp cloth. Wooden frames on the contrary, may need regular treatment to guard them against rot or mould.

Composite Front Doors

You're looking to get a front door that is not just stunning, but also has foolproof security features. It is advisable to think about the composite door. These contemporary composite doors are constructed of a mixture of materials and appear like timber. They are extremely durable and last for up to 35 years. They require only a wipe-down every now and then. They also provide excellent insulation and are draughtproof.

Contrary to uPVC and wood the composite front doors don't shrink or crack from exposure to sunlight. They are also immune to damage from pests and waterproof. Moreover, they have a strengthened skin and are designed to withstand the UK's harsh weather conditions. They come in a range of colours and styles to complement the exterior of your home.

Additionally, they come with solid cores that have an insulated core filled with foam to give you the best thermal efficiency you can get. You can save money by reducing the cost of heating. UPVC Front Doors

A uPVC front door is a great choice for homeowners looking to improve their homes' energy efficient. They also offer an attractive appearance that is easy to maintain. Doors are available in a broad selection of styles and colours to meet your needs. They are less expensive than wooden front doors, and they can save you cash on heating costs. They are also resistant to moisture and are durable.

uPVC doors can also be reinforced for increased security. They can withstand greater pressure than wooden front doors and be able to withstand the force of an intruder who tries to kick them. Upvc won't rust, rot or fade. A uPVC door will last for years and is an investment that will pay back in the long run.

uPVC doors require little maintenance, and don't need to be stained or painted. They are also energy-efficient, so they can keep your home warm during the winter months. uPVC will also help in reducing the sound levels inside your home.
